Can Feather Pillows Cause Allergies?

Feather pillows are often associated with comfort and luxury, but many people believe they are a breeding ground for allergens. This perception leads some to avoid them, assuming the feather filling causes nighttime irritation. However, the true culprits behind a restless, congested night are usually microscopic organisms and particles that accumulate over time, not the natural materials themselves. The science reveals that the material matters less than the maintenance, and the allergy is frequently misidentified. This article investigates the actual causes of allergic reactions linked to bedding and offers strategies for a healthier sleep environment.

Identifying the True Allergens

A genuine allergy to the protein keratin found in feathers and down is quite rare. When this allergy occurs, it is a direct immune response to the feather material itself. However, most people experiencing allergy symptoms from a feather pillow are reacting to secondary factors trapped inside the bedding.

The primary allergen is the dust mite, a microscopic arachnid that thrives in warm, humid environments. The allergic reaction is caused by proteins found in their fecal matter and decaying body fragments, such as Der p 1 and Der f 1. These microscopic droppings are easily inhaled during sleep, leading to respiratory symptoms.

Pillows also collect other common indoor allergens, including mold, mildew, and pet dander. Mold spores flourish if the pillow retains moisture from sweat or high humidity. These secondary allergens are often the true cause of symptoms, mistakenly blamed on the feather filling.

Common Symptoms of Pillow Allergies

Exposure to pillow allergens typically manifests as a localized reaction that worsens during the night or immediately upon waking. The most frequent symptoms involve the upper respiratory system, often mimicking a persistent cold or hay fever. This includes persistent sneezing, a runny nose, and nasal congestion.

The eyes are highly susceptible to irritation from microscopic allergens. Symptoms include itchy, watery, or red eyes, which are signs of allergic conjunctivitis. For individuals with asthma, exposure can trigger coughing, wheezing, or shortness of breath. Direct contact can also cause skin reactions, such as flare-ups of eczema or hives.

Strategies for Reducing Allergen Exposure

The most effective action to mitigate pillow allergens is to create a physical barrier around the pillow fill. Using zippered, allergen-proof encasements made of tightly woven material prevents dust mites and their waste from passing through to the sleeper. These covers should be washed every two to four weeks alongside regular bedding.

To eradicate dust mites and wash away accumulated allergens, all bedding must be washed frequently in hot water. Water temperatures of 130°F (54°C) or higher are required to effectively kill house dust mites. For the pillow itself, checking the care label is important, but a quarterly wash can significantly reduce the internal allergen load.

Pillows should be replaced regularly, as old pillows accumulate allergens and lose structural integrity despite cleaning. Most experts recommend replacement every two to three years. Using a clothes dryer on a high-heat setting for at least 15 minutes can also kill dust mites in items that cannot be hot-water washed.

Feather Versus Synthetic Pillow Comparison

For many years, synthetic pillows were promoted as the superior hypoallergenic choice over feather options. However, research suggests that the pillow’s casing is the more important factor than the fill material. The tightly woven fabric used for quality feather pillows often acts as a natural barrier, making the pillow less permeable to dust mites and their allergens.

Standard synthetic pillows, typically filled with polyester, often use a looser weave easily penetrated by dust mites. Some studies show that synthetic pillows can accumulate significantly higher levels of dust mite allergens than feather pillows. While synthetic fibers are not allergenic, their construction may create a more inviting habitat for mites.

Ultimately, both feather and synthetic pillows accumulate allergens without proper care. Synthetic options, such as down alternatives, are generally easier to wash and dry frequently, which benefits severe allergy sufferers. The decision should be based on personal comfort and the commitment to using allergen-proof covers and a consistent hot-water washing schedule.
